Kent Fire and Rescue are currently dealing with a fire at Dartford Heath, and trhe public are being advised to stay clear of the area.
Also today, firefighters have been tackling a blaze at a garage in Sidcup, south east London.
Four fire engines and around 25 firefighters were called to Blackfen Road after midday, but the fire has since been controlled, despite damaging the garage and surrounding fence.
And according to Kent Fire and Rescue, approximately 300 square metres of the heathland have been alight since around 4pm today, July 22.
Six fire engines and all-terrain vehicles are in attendance and the fire is ongoing.
Kent Fire and Rescue say there are no reported injuries, and the cause of the fire is not yet known in either cases.
